How to operate an automatic transmission (AT)

Step 1: Getting to know the gear selector

* P (Parking): Locks the wheels, designed for parking and towing.
* R (Reverse): Engages reverse gear.
* N (Neutral): Disconnects the transmission from the engine, like a «manual neutral».
* D (Drive): Primary gear for normal driving.
* [Numbers 1 to 3]: Manual modes that block transmission on a specified number.
